Responsibilities
Provides operational support to Mayo Clinic multi-media systems and customers, including but not limited to: equipment trouble-shooting; deliveries and setup; basic equipment maintenance; multi-media technology displays; support for on and off campus multi-media events; audio and video systems; audience response system operations, studio and single camera operation that may include patient procedures, floor director support, video conference directing, and basic video network technologies. Provides and manages the planning and coordination for internal and external events in designated areas of responsibility, which may include customer support, videoconferencing, meeting support and production. May provide troubleshooting and help-desk support for Media Support Services customers, master control operations, off-campus multi-media event support, live and post-video production services (e.g. lighting, audio, recording, directing, editing and media duplication for internal and external use; and on-call support for video-on-demand. Participates in the room design and audiovisual equipment purchases by making recommendations. Utilizes and demonstrates proficiency in all types of recording modalities (e.g. tape, hard drive, remote server, and webcast capture stations). Incumbents are expected to stay current in all existing and emerging presentation technologies (hardware, software, equipment, etc.) and will be required to complete job-related mandatory training and education requirements. May provide training and mentorship to other event support team members as directed by MSS leadership. May assist in other job related responsibilities as determined by workload and manager. This position requires adherence to the Mayo confidentiality policy. The incumbent is required to work extended hours including early mornings, evenings, and weekends. Hours will vary to meet the requirements of the job.
Qualifications
High School Diploma/GED and 7 years of professional employment experience in daily operations within a multi-media or audiovisual/videoconference facility
Associate’s degree in Media, Business Communication or technically related field and 5 years of professional employment experience in daily operations within a multi-media support facility
Bachelor’s degree in Media, Business Communications or technically related field and 3 years of professional employment experience in daily operations within a multi-media support facility preferred.
Demonstrated proficiency with MAC & PC computer platforms, operating systems, and Microsoft Office products. Demonstrated proficiency and ability to learn software and technologies for job tracking, trouble ticket reporting, audience response systems, video network control software, and remote access. Demonstrated ability to work independently and problem solve complex issues.
